"Open Database Connectivity" (ODBC) yra protokolas, kurį naudodami „Microsoft“„Access“ duomenų bazę galite prijungti prie išorinio duomenų šaltinio, pvz., „Microsoft“SQL serveris. Šiame straipsnyje pateikiama bendra informacija apie ODBC duomenų šaltinius, kaip juos sukurti ir kaip prie jų prisijungti naudojant „Access“. Procedūros veiksmų gali skirtis, atsižvelgiant į konkrečius duomenų bazės produktus ir naudojamas ODBC tvarkykles.
Šiame straipsnyje:
Apie ODBC duomenų šaltinius
Duomenų šaltinis yra duomenų, derinamų su ryšio informaciją, kurios reikia duomenims pasiekti, šaltinis. Duomenų šaltinių pavyzdžiai yra SQL serveris, "Oracle RDBMS", skaičiuoklė ir teksto failas. Ryšio informacijos pavyzdžiai gali būti serverio vietą, duomenų bazės pavadinimas, prisijungimo ID, slaptažodis ir įvairios ODBC tvarkyklės parinktys, aprašančios, kaip prisijungti prie duomenų šaltinio. Šią informaciją galima gauti iš duomenų bazės, prie kurios norite prisijungti, administratoriaus.
ODBC architektūros programoje, pvz., „Access“, prisijungia prie ODBC tvarkyklių tvarkytuvo, kuris savo ruožtu naudoja konkrečią ODBC tvarkyklę (pvz., „Microsoft“ SQL ODBC tvarkyklę), kad prisijungtų prie duomenų šaltinio. " „Access“ " naudojate ODBC duomenų šaltinius, kad prisijungtumėte prie išorinių duomenų šaltinių su „Access“, kuriuose nėra įtaisytųjų tvarkyklių.
Norėdami prisijungti prie šių duomenų šaltinių, turite atlikti šiuos veiksmus:
-
Įdiekite atitinkamą ODBC tvarkyklę kompiuteryje, kuriame yra duomenų šaltinis.
-
Apibrėžkite duomenų šaltinio pavadinimą (DSN) naudodami ODBC duomenų šaltinio administratorių ryšio informacijai saugoti „Microsoft“Windows registre arba DSN faile, arba jungimosi eilutę Visual Basic kode, kad perduotumėte ryšio informaciją tiesiogiai ODBC tvarkyklių tvarkytuvei.
Kompiuterio duomenų šaltiniai
Kompiuterio duomenų šaltiniai ryšio informaciją saugo konkrečiame kompiuteryje Windows registre. Kompiuterio duomenų šaltinius galite naudoti tik tame kompiuteryje, kuriame jie yra apibrėžti. Yra dviejų tipų kompiuterio duomenų šaltiniai: vartotojo ir sistemos. Vartotojo duomenų šaltinius gali naudoti tik dabartinis vartotojas ir jie matomi tik tam vartotojui. Sistemos duomenų šaltinius gali naudoti visi vartotojai kompiuteryje ir jie yra matomi visiems to kompiuterio ir sistemos paslaugų vartotojams. Kompiuterio duomenų šaltinis yra ypač naudingas, kai norite suteikti papildomą saugą, nes kompiuterio duomenų šaltinį gali peržiūrėti tik prisijungę vartotojai ir nuotolinis vartotojas jo negali nukopijuoti į kitą kompiuterį.
Failo duomenų šaltinis
Failo duomenų šaltiniuose (dar vadinamuose DSN failais) ryšio informacija saugoma tekstiniame faile, o ne Windows registre ir paprastai yra lankstesnė naudoti nei kompiuterio duomenų šaltiniai. Pavyzdžiui, galite kopijuoti duomenų šaltinį į bet kurį kompiuterį, kuriame yra tinkama ODBC tvarkyklė, kad jūsų programa būtų paremta patikima ir tikslia ryšio informacija visuose kompiuteriuose. Arba galite įtraukti failo duomenų šaltinį viename serveryje, jį bendrinti su daugeliu kompiuterių tinkle ir lengvai tvarkyti ryšio informaciją vienoje vietoje.
Failo duomenų šaltinį galite padaryti nebendrinamą. Nebendrinamas failo duomenų šaltinis yra viename kompiuteryje ir nukreipia į kompiuterio duomenų šaltinį. Nebendrinamų failo duomenų šaltinius galite naudoti norėdami iš failo duomenų šaltinių pasiekti esamus kompiuterio duomenų šaltinius.
Ryšio eilutės
Modulyje galite apibrėžti suformatuotą ryšio eilutę, kuri nurodo ryšio informaciją. Eilutė perduoda ryšio informaciją tiesiai į ODBC tvarkyklės tvarkytuvą ir padeda supaprastinti programą pašalindama reikalavimą, kad sistemos administratorius ar vartotojas, prieš pradėdamas naudoti duomenų bazę, turi sukurti DNS .
Daugiau informacijos apie ODBC sąsają rasite MSDN skyriuje ODBC programuotojo gairės.
ODBC duomenų šaltinio įtraukimas
Prieš tęsdami, įsigykite ir įdiekite atitinkamą duomenų šaltinio, prie kurio norite prisijungti, ODBC tvarkyklę.
Pastaba: Norėdami įtraukti arba konfigūruoti ODBC duomenų šaltinį, vietiniame kompiuteryje turite būti administratorių grupės narys.
-
Spustelėkite Pradėti, tada spustelėkite Valdymo skydas.
-
Valdymo skyde du kartus spustelėkite Administravimo įrankiai.
-
Dialogo lange Administravimo įrankiai dukart spustelėkite Duomenų šaltiniai (ODBC).
Rodomas dialogo langas ODBC duomenų šaltinio administratorius
-
Spustelėkite Vartotojo DSN, Sistemos DSN arba Failo DSN, atsižvelgdami į duomenų šaltinio, kurį norite įtraukti, tipą. Daugiau informacijos žr. skyriuje Apie ODBC duomenų šaltinius.
-
Spustelėkite Įtraukti.
-
Pasirinkite norimą naudoti tvarkyklę, tada spustelėkite Baigti arba Toliau.
Jei norimos tvarkyklės sąraše nėra, kreipkitės į duomenų bazės, prie kurios bandote prisijungti, administratorių ir gaukite informacijos, kaip gauti tinkamą tvarkyklę.
-
Vykdykite nurodymus ir į visus dialogo langus įveskite reikiamą ryšio informaciją.
ODBC dialogo languose spustelėkite Žinynas norėdami gauti daugiau informacijos apie atskirus parametrus.